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Amazon SNS propose un ensemble complet de fonctionnalités conçues pour améliorer la messagerie entre les applications et les utilisateurs. Ces fonctionnalités permettent une communication fluide, une transmission sécurisée des messages et une gestion robuste des messages, garantissant une disponibilité, une durabilité et une flexibilité élevées pour un large éventail de cas d'utilisation de la messagerie.
- Application-to-application messagerie
-
Une pplication-to-application messagerie prend en charge les abonnés tels que les flux de diffusion Amazon Data Firehose, les fonctions Lambda, les files d'attente Amazon SQS, les points de terminaison HTTP/S et les pipelines Event Fork. AWS Cela permet une distribution efficace des messages dans les architectures pilotées par les événements.
- Application-to-person notifications
-
pplication-to-personLes notifications fournissent des notifications aux utilisateurs aux abonnés, telles que les applications mobiles, les numéros de téléphone portable et les adresses e-mail.
- Rubriques standard et FIFO
-
Les rubriques FIFO garantissent un ordre, un regroupement et une déduplication stricts des messages, ce qui permet aux FIFO et aux files d'attente standard de s'abonner pour le traitement des messages. Les rubriques standard sont utilisées lorsque le classement des messages et les éventuelles duplications ne sont pas critiques, prenant en charge tous les protocoles de diffusion pour des cas d'utilisation plus larges.
- Durabilité des messages
-
Amazon SNS utilise un certain nombre de stratégies qui fonctionnent ensemble pour assurer la durabilité des messages :
-
Les messages publiés sont stockés sur plusieurs serveurs et centres de données séparés géographiquement.
-
Si aucun point de terminaison abonné n'est disponible, Amazon SNS exécute une stratégie de nouvelle tentative de livraison.
-
Pour conserver tous les messages qui ne sont pas remis avant la fin de la stratégie de nouvelle tentative de livraison, vous pouvez créer une file d'attente de lettres mortes.
-
- Archivage, relecture et analyse des messages
-
Vous pouvez archiver les messages avec Amazon SNS de différentes manières, notamment en abonnant les flux de diffusion Firehose aux rubriques SNS, ce qui vous permet d'envoyer des notifications à des points de terminaison d'analyse tels que les buckets Amazon Simple Storage Service (Amazon S3), les tables Amazon Redshift, etc. Par ailleurs, les rubriques FIFO d'Amazon SNS prennent en charge l'archivage-relecture des messages sous forme d'archive de messages sur place et sans code, ce qui permet aux propriétaires de rubrique de stocker (ou archiver) les messages dans leur rubrique. Les abonnés à une rubrique peuvent ensuite récupérer (ou relire) les messages archivés sur un point de terminaison abonné. Pour en savoir plus, consultez Archivage et rediffusion des messages Amazon SNS pour les rubriques FIFO.
- Attributs de message
-
Attributs de message Amazon SNSvous permet de fournir des métadonnées arbitraires concernant le message.
- Filtrage de messages
-
Par défaut, un abonné reçoit chaque message publié dans la rubrique. Pour recevoir uniquement un sous-ensemble des messages, un abonné doit attribuer une politique de filtre à l'abonnement à la rubrique. Un abonné peut également définir l'étendue de la politique de filtre pour activer le filtrage basé sur la charge utile ou sur les attributs. La valeur par défaut pour l'étendue de la politique de filtre est
MessageAttributes
. Lorsque les attributs de message entrant correspondent aux attributs de stratégie de filtrage, le message est remis au point de terminaison abonné. Sinon, le message est filtré. Lorsque l'étendue de la politique de filtre estMessageBody
, les attributs de la politique de filtre sont mis en correspondance avec la charge utile. Pour de plus amples informations, veuillez consulter Filtrage des messages Amazon SNS. - Sécurité des messages
-
Le chiffrement côté serveur protège le contenu des messages stockés dans les rubriques Amazon SNS à l'aide des clés de chiffrement fournies par. AWS KMS Pour plus d'informations, consultez Sécurisation des données Amazon SNS grâce au chiffrement côté serveur Vous pouvez également établir une connexion privée entre Amazon SNS et votre cloud privé virtuel (VPC). Pour plus d'informations, consultez. Sécurisation du trafic Amazon SNS avec des points de terminaison VPC